From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) [web1913]:
Bush \Bush\, v. t. [imp. & p. p. {Bushed} (?); p. pr & vb n.
{Bushing}.]
1. To set bushes for to support with bushes; as to bush
peas.
2. To use a bush harrow on (land), for covering seeds sown;
to harrow with a bush; as to bush a piece of land; to
bush seeds into the ground.
From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) [web1913]:
Bushing \Bush"ing\, n. [See 4th {Bush}.]
1. The operation of fitting bushes, or linings, into holes or
places where wear is to be received, or friction
diminished, as pivot holes, etc
2. (Mech.) A bush or lining; -- sometimes called a {thimble}.
See 4th {Bush}.
From WordNet r 1.6 [wn]:
bushing
n : a cylindrical metal lining used to reduce friction [syn: {cylindrical
lining}]
